How to Find an Electrician

There are a few aspects to look for in an electrician in Leighton Buzzard, or anywhere else in the UK. These include experience, qualifications, and insurance.

To ensure your safety You should always choose an electrician who is registered with a government-approved scheme. This includes NICEIC and the Register of Competent Electrical Persons.

Qualifications

It is essential to hire qualified electricians for electrical installation work in Leighton Buzzard. The easiest method of confirming an electrician is to ask for their National Inspection Council for Electrical Installation Contracting (NICEIC) ID card. This enables you to verify their qualifications and training as well as their insurance.


You can also use the NICEIC online tool to find out whether the contractor is a registered member of any government-approved scheme. These will guarantee that the electrician is certified to an extremely high level and has passed an assessment that cover samples of their work, premises documents, equipment, and premises.

The NICEIC Register is a good place for you to start your search to find an electrician with a certification. It indicates that they have met all the requirements and passed all exams. Another option is the FMB scheme. This ensures that an electrician has been inspected and checked before they are accepted into this register.
